Servicemember Discounts

Many retailers offer military and veteran discounts, such as popular gift brands like Apple®1, Microsoft® and Nike®. While out shopping, don’t forget the necessary ID—acceptable IDs include your Common Access Card (CAC), Dependent Card (DD Form 1173) or Veterans ID Card (VIC).

If you plan on traveling for the holidays, companies like Southwest Airlines, United Airlines and American Airlines offer discounts on flights (but you may have to call to book). Looking to give your loved ones an experience instead of an item? Both Disney Resorts® and Carnival Cruises Lines® have deals for servicemembers. Armed Forces Vacation Club also offers discounted resort stays for solo or family trips. 

If you’re unsure if a store offers a military discount, don’t be afraid to ask. Often, retailers won’t advertise their discount programs, but they’re available upon request.

Military Exchange

As a military servicemember, you have access to your local military exchange. You can find name-brand items that are sold tax-free at an exchange, making it an easy way to shop smarter during the holidays. Don’t have a lot of time? You can shop the exchange online. All you’ll need to do is register on your military branch’s exchange website with your Social Security Number and date of birth to prove you’re enlisted.
